PREDICTION OF OOCYTE OUTPUT: How can we maximize the oocyte retrieving from follicles in Controlled Ovarian Hyperstimulation cycles? Abstract Aim: We designed our study with the purpose of determining which variables should be used to predict oocyte output, to increase the number of collected oocytes and the success rate of IVF. Materials and Method: A total of 412 infertile patients admitted to the IVF center of a tertiary university hospital between the years 2016 and 2018 were evaluated retrospectively. The number of oocytes obtained by OPU from the follicles as the result of COH was grouped in percentiles. The variables effective on oocyte output were analyzed in the groups, and tests to predict acquisition of the maximal number of oocytes were tried to be determined. Results: When we investigated according to the oocyte/≥ 14 mm follicle ratios, we determined that 10.2% of the patients were in the ≤ 30% group, whereas 4.1% of them were in the group of 31-40 %. 6.6% of the patients were in the group of 41-50 %, 2.9% in the group of 51-60%, 5.6% in the group of 61-70 %, 8% in the group of 71-80%, 4.9% in the group of 81-90 %, and 57.8% in the group of 91-100 %. According to the results of our study, the variables effective on the oocyte/≥14 mm follicle ratio were the patient’s age, basal FSH value (cutoff 9.5mIU/mL, sensitivity 0.706, specificity 0.621, p=0.001), basal LH (cutoff 5.5mIU/mL, sensitivity 0.640 specificity 0.690, p<0.001), AMH (cutoff 0.280ng/mL, sensitivity 0.748 specificity 0.684, p<0.001), trigger day E2 (cutoff 388.50pg/mL, sensitivity 0.774, specificity 0.774, p<0.001) and the number of ≥17 mm follicles on the trigger day. The area under the curve (AUC) was 0.734for AMH, 0.768 for trigger day E2, and 0.721 for basal LH, having a good predictivity. The AUC was 0.623 for basal E2, and 0.685 for basal FSH value, having poor predictivity. Conclusion: The variables effective on oocyte output were the basal (day 2-4) FSH, LH, and AMH values, together with trigger day E2 value and the number of ≥17 mm follicles on the trigger day. AMH, basal LH, and trigger day E2 have good predictivity regarding oocyte output. Keywords: Oocyte output, Assisted Reproductive Technologies, Oocyte pick-up
